Cargo turnover of Odessa Commercial Seaport (Ukraine) up 4.15% in 10M06

In January-October Odessa Commercial Seaport (OCS) transshipped 23.615 million tons of cargo (+4.15% against year-on-year result), OCS’s press center reports according to IA REGNUM. The result is attributed to growing transshipment of dry cargo - 12.642 million tons in January-October 2006 (+8.5% year-on-year). However, transshipment of liquid bulk cargo fell by 0.5% to 10.972 million tons.

Odessa Commercial Seaport is located in the south-western part of Odessa Bay at reclaimed territory covering 109.5 hectares. The capacity of the company’s facilities enables it to handle over 14 million tons of dry cargo and 24 million tons of liquid bulk cargo annually. The port accepts vessels with length up to 270 m and draft up to 13 m. Total length of the berths is over 8 km.
